PZA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2015 in Review

86 of the 3,812 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co National AMT-Free Municipal Bond ETF (PZA) for Q4 2015, worth a combined $455M — up 15% from $398M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 17 funds opened new PZA positions and 8 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 32 added to existing stakes and 20 trimmed.

The largest buyer was UBS Group, adding an estimated $11.4M. The largest seller was Jane Street,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.16M sold.
